A street level target, identified as Ernesto Espera, 46, was arrested with a gun in his possession during a drug buy-bust operation conducted by operatives of the Victorias City Police Station in Barangay 5, Victorias City, Negros Occidental on Saturday, Nov. 28.

                P/Lt. Col. Eduardo Corpuz, who led the operation, said Espera, of the barangay, was nabbed with 15 small heat-sealed plastic sachets of suspected shabu, weighing about 5 grams and worth P34,000, drug paraphernalia, and a 9mm Luger pistol with ammunition.

                Corpuz added they subjected Espera to many months of surveillance operations because his illegal drug business is on and off, and he keeps on transferring address.

He said the suspect gets his supply of drugs from Bacolod City.

                The police said Espera denied owning the gun but he will still be charged for violating Republic Act 10591, or the Comprehensive Firearms and Ammunition Regulation Act, in addition to the drug case. – Mitch Lipa
